chore(linting): refresh configs and sweep auto-fix
Pull in the refreshed linter and tooling configs (editorconfig, gitignore, gitattributes, prettierignore, prettierrc, markdownlint, yamllint, env.example, dotnet-tools) and run prettier and markdownlint in --fix / --write mode across the repo so the existing tree matches the new rules. - prettier 2-space indent on yaml/yml and json overrides, asterisk strong, underscore emphasis, proseWrap always - markdownlint MD007 indent aligned to 2 and MD049 to underscore so prettier output stays passing - preflight Block F also ignores CLAUDE.md (gitignored personal file) - prettierignore extended to keep HellionChat.yaml manifest and the NuGet packages.lock.json out of the formatter No semantic content changed; csharpier, build, full build-suite (729/729) and the new prettier/markdownlint/yamllint checks all green.
